Analysis

The most recent figure for singapore — industrial roundwood, non-coniferous non-tropical in Indonesia is 6 1000 USD, measured in 2014.

The figure is up 200.0% on the previous year and down 75.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, singapore — industrial roundwood, non-coniferous non-tropical in Indonesia peaked at 2,584 1000 USD in 2005 and was at its lowest, 1 1000 USD, in 2006.

Indonesia ranks 23rd of 26 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
